Day 3-4: Gulmarg - Winter Sports Capital (Jammu Kashmir Tour Package)

Gulmarg November Attractions
Gondola Cable Car Adventure: Phase 2 to Apharwat often suspends operations in November due to high winds and early snowfall. Only Phase 1 might be operational, weather permitting.
- Phase 1 (Gulmarg to Kongdoori): Stunning valley panoramas at 8,530 feet when operational
- Phase 2 (Kongdoori to Apharwat): Snow-covered peaks at 13,780 feet
- Early winter activities: Pre-skiing season with hiking and photography opportunities

What Kashmir Food To Experience in the November Tour
Seasonal Kashmiri Cuisine
- Harissa: Traditional meat dish perfect for cold weather
- Kahwa: Saffron tea keeps you warm throughout the day
- Rogan Josh: Rich lamb curry ideal for November evenings
- Yakhni: Yoghurt-based curry with warming spices
- Sheer Chai: Pink salt tea, a local November favourite

Technical Tips for November Photography
- Use polarising filters to enhance sky contrast and reduce glare
- Protect equipment from moisture and temperature changes
- Extra batteries are essential as cold weather drains power quickly
- Golden hour timing differs in November (later sunrise, earlier sunset)
- Snow photography settings require exposure compensation

Transportation Options for Kashmir Tour Packages
Reaching Kashmir in November
- By Air: Srinagar Airport with direct flights from Delhi, Mumbai, Kolkata
- By Road: Delhi to Srinagar (876 km) via Jammu highway
- By Train: Train to Jammu Tawi, then road journey to Srinagar

Is there snowfall in Srinagar in November?
Light snowfall is possible in late November, especially in higher areas around Srinagar. Gulmarg and Sonamarg typically receive their first significant snowfall in November, while Srinagar city may see occasional snow towards the end of the month, making it magical for Kashmir tour packages.
